Ellicott City is one of Howard County’s most distinctive communities — historic Old Ellicott City along the Patapsco River, established mid-century neighborhoods, and the newer upscale developments spreading through western Howard County toward the Carroll County line. Each area presents different garage door challenges.

Historic Old Ellicott City and properties near the river are flood-aware communities. We understand that flooding doesn’t just damage panels — it corrodes springs, ruins opener electronics, warps tracks, and destroys weatherseals. After any significant flood event, we strongly advise against operating your garage door until it’s been professionally inspected. We provide written inspection reports that can support insurance claims.

Can flooding damage a garage door system?

Yes — and Ellicott City homeowners know this better than most. Flood water warps wood panels, corrodes steel tracks and springs, shorts out opener circuit boards, and destroys weatherseals. After any significant flooding event, we recommend a full inspection before operating your door. Using a flooded opener can cause electrical failure or fire.
